WebPrimary lactose intolerance rare; usually secondary to gastroenteritis and transient, usually lasting approx 4 to 6 weeks. Treat with a lactose free formula (e.g. Aptamil Lactose Free, Enfamil O-Lac, SMA Lactofree), not a hypoallergenic milk free formula. A small number of infants have a longer term problem with lactose. Lactose-free infant formulas are … WebLactose free is the same as dairy free, right? Wrong. Lactose free doesn’t always mean dairy free, and lactose free is not the same as dairy free. Products labelled as lactose free still contain dairy: they are simply milk products without the sometimes-problematic-sugars, whereas dairy free means there’s neither dairy nor lactose.

WebJan 11, 2024 · Lactose plays a crucial role in the growth performance of pigs at weaning because it is a palatable and easily digestible energy source that eases the transition from milk to solid feed. However, the digestibility of lactose declines after weaning due to a reduction in endogenous lactase activity in piglets. WebMay 12, 2024 · If your baby is less than 4 months of age, you can start dairy free weaning with puree of vegetables and then fruit. Simply peel, chop and then cover with water to cook in a saucepan. Mash with a fork using the water in the pan, breast milk or your baby’s special infant formula.
